A Conversation with Maryse Carmichael

April 7, 2021 @ 6:30PM Mountain

Join one of Canada’s aviation and aerospace leaders for some Q&A and conversation about becoming a successful professional in this important sector.

You may know Maryse as the first female Commanding Officer of Canada’s Snowbird team, now a successful leader in Canada’s aerospace industry. A retired RCAF military pilot (LCol ret’d) and with roots to her childhood as an Air Cadet, Maryse will engage in discussion with registrants on career pathways for those interested in exciting opportunities as professionals in this important field.
